Sterling Silver Tubular Component or Band with 925 Hallmark

This item is a circular, tubular component constructed from what appears to be precious metal. The physical characteristics indicate a cast or machined cylindrical form with a flattened rim. The most significant feature is the stamped '925' hallmark on the rim, which identifies the piece as sterling silver, signifying a purity of 92.5 percent silver alloyed with 7.5 percent other metals, typically copper. The color displays a yellowish-gold tarnish, suggesting several possibilities: the silver has developed a significant aged patina, it was originally gold-plated (vermeil), or the lighting conditions are influencing the visual hue. The surface displays moderate wear with visible micro-abrasions, small scuffs, and minor pitting consistent with a pre-owned or vintage high-purity metal item. The craftsmanship shows a clean, uniform strike on the hallmark and a relatively smooth finish on the metal surfaces. Given its shape and size relative to the fingers shown, this could be a component of a larger jewelry piece, a decorative ferrule, a writing instrument part, or a heavy-gauge band. The contemporary style of the hallmark font suggests an estimated age from the late 20th century to the present. The interior appears dark and hollow, indicating a functional rather than purely decorative structural role.
